I decided to go with the whimsical look – and kept it VERY clean and simple. I love the look of mixing designer papers, but I struggle with doing it, especially when I’m trying to stay CAS. However, I’ve found that if I stick to the smaller prints, and use the simplest of the patterns as my focal panel, it’s more appealing to the eye – more balanced. So that’s what I’ve done here.
